Taylor Farms Texas has a career opportunity available for a talented and motivated individual to join our team as Buyer in the Dallas, TX area.

As a Buyer you will be responsible for buying the necessary ingredients and packaging that is need to complete our products. You will keep track of the quantity and quality of purchased items to help maintain our high standards of products and inventory levels.

Responsibilities & Duties: 
  • Estimating and purchasing of packing and ingredients as needed.
  • Managing and coordinating new packaging needs. 
  • Assist with daily order planners. 
  • Examine, select, order and purchase products at the most favorable price, consistent with quality, quantity, specification requirements and other established factors.
  • Management of perishable inventory purchased by daily review of item usage, sales, inventory adjustments, and the creation of purchase orders to replenish inventory.
  • Interface with all departments and resolve problems and issues.
  • Must be able to build teams and establish relationships.
  • Work as a team with sales, warehousing, distribution and logistics.
  • Work in conjunction with senior management on any additional projects or needs.
